日韩性视频-久久久蜜桃-www中文字幕-在线中文字幕av-亚洲欧美一区二区三区四区-撸久久-香蕉视频一区-久久无码精品丰满人妻-国产高潮av-激情福利社-日韩av网址大全-国产精品久久999-日本五十路在线-性欧美在线-久久99精品波多结衣一区-男女午夜免费视频-黑人极品ⅴideos精品欧美棵-人人妻人人澡人人爽精品欧美一区-日韩一区在线看-欧美a级在线免费观看

歡迎訪問 生活随笔!

生活随笔

當(dāng)前位置: 首頁 > 编程资源 > 编程问答 >内容正文

编程问答

oracle日期相减工作日_Oracle 计算两个日期间隔的天数、月数和年数

發(fā)布時間:2025/3/21 编程问答 37 豆豆
生活随笔 收集整理的這篇文章主要介紹了 oracle日期相减工作日_Oracle 计算两个日期间隔的天数、月数和年数 小編覺得挺不錯的,現(xiàn)在分享給大家,幫大家做個參考.

在Oracle中計算兩個日期間隔的天數(shù)、月數(shù)和年數(shù):

一、天數(shù):

在Oracle中,兩個日期直接相減,便可以得到天數(shù);

select to_date('08/06/2015','mm/dd/yyyy')-to_date('07/01/2015','mm/dd/yyyy') from dual;

返回結(jié)果:36

二、月數(shù):

計算月數(shù),需要用到months_between函數(shù);

--months_between(date1,date2)

--如果兩個日期中“日”相同,或分別是所在月的最后一天,那么返回的結(jié)果是整數(shù)。否則,返回的結(jié)果將包含一個分?jǐn)?shù)部分(以31天為一月計算)

select months_between(to_date('01/31/2015','mm/dd/yyyy'),to_date('12/31/2014','mm/dd/yyyy')) "MONTHS" FROM DUAL;

返回結(jié)果:

select months_between(to_date('01/01/2015','mm/dd/yyyy'),to_date('12/31/2014','mm/dd/yyyy')) "MONTHS" FROM DUAL;

返回結(jié)果: 0.032258064516129

select abs(trunc(months_between(sysdate , to_date('01/31/2015','mm/dd/yyyy'))))from dual;

select ceil(trunc(months_between(sysdate , to_date('01/31/2015','mm/dd/yyyy'))))from dual;

select floor(trunc(months_between(sysdate , to_date('01/31/2015','mm/dd/yyyy'))))from dual;

三、年數(shù):

計算年數(shù),是通過計算出月數(shù),然后再除以12;(也許會有更好的辦法,目前還不知道)

select trunc(months_between(to_date('08/06/2015','mm/dd/yyyy'),to_date('08/06/2013','mm/dd/yyyy'))/) from dual;

--返回結(jié)果:

在Oracle中計算兩個日期間隔的天數(shù)、月數(shù)和年數(shù)

一.天數(shù): 在Oracle中,兩個日期直接相減,便可以得到天數(shù): select to_date('08/06/2015','mm/dd/yyyy')-to_date('07/01/2015','mm/ ...

oracle中計算兩個日期的相差天數(shù)、月數(shù)、年數(shù)、小時數(shù)、分鐘數(shù)、秒數(shù)等

oracle如何計算兩個日期的相差天數(shù).月數(shù).年數(shù).小時數(shù).分鐘數(shù).秒數(shù) 1.相差天數(shù)(兩個日期相減) --Oracle中兩個日期相差天數(shù)-- select TO_NUMBER(TO_DATE('20 ...

Java8 使用LocalDate計算兩個日期間隔多少年,多少月,多少天

最近項目遇到一個需要計算兩個日期間隔的期限,需要計算出,整年整月整日這樣符合日常習(xí)慣的說法,利用之前的Date和Calendar類會有點復(fù)雜,剛好項目使用了JDK8,那就利用起來這個新特性,上代碼: ...

java計算兩個日期之間的天數(shù),排除節(jié)假日和周末

如題所說,計算兩個日期之前的天數(shù),排除節(jié)假日和周末.這里天數(shù)的類型為double,因為該功能實現(xiàn)的是請假天數(shù)的計算,有請一上午假的為0.5天. 不夠很坑的是每個日期都要查詢數(shù)據(jù)庫,感覺很浪費時間. 原 ...

ORACLE判斷兩個日期間隔幾個工作日

CreateTime--2017年9月7日17:14:56 Author:Marydon ORACLE判斷兩個日期間隔幾個工作日 方法:使用存儲過程 /** * 判斷兩個日期間隔幾個工作日 */ ...

計算兩個日期相差的天數(shù) js php日期 減一年

計算兩個日期相差的天數(shù) //sDate1和sDate2是yyyy-MM-dd格式 function dateDiff(sDate1, sDate2) { var aDate, oDate1, oDat ...

JS計算兩個日期之間的天數(shù)

alse" :picker-options="pickerOptions0" val ...

iOS 計算兩個日期之間的天數(shù)問題

//獲取當(dāng)前時間若干年.月.日之后的時間 + (NSDate *)dateWithFromDate:(NSDate *)date years:(NSInteger)years months:(NSIn ...

隨機推薦

@Autowired 與@Resource的區(qū)別

1.@Autowired與@Resource都可以用來裝配bean. 都可以寫在字段上,或?qū)懺趕etter方法上. 2? @Autowired默認(rèn)按類型裝配(這個注解是屬業(yè)spring的),默認(rèn)情況下 ...

利用tween.js算法生成緩動效果

在講tween類之前,不得不提的是貝塞爾曲線了.首先,貝塞爾曲線是指依據(jù)四個位置任意的點坐標(biāo)繪制出的一條光滑曲線.它在作圖工具或動畫中中運用得比較多,例如PS中的鋼筆工具,firework中的畫筆等等 ...

web初學(xué)之MVC

之前對JavaEE的MVC模式有些許了解,但一直沒有很好的掌握,在讀代碼時候也很模糊不清.因此對MVC又通過各種資料有了全面的理解. 一.首先,需要從了解JavaEE技術(shù)開始.JavaEE技術(shù)在設(shè)計程 ...

itext 實現(xiàn)pdf打印數(shù)字上標(biāo)和下標(biāo)

https://kathleen1974.wordpress.com/category/itext-pdf/ In one of my project, we need to give the use ...

解決兩臺虛擬機互ping可通,但connect失敗

問題描述: 在UNP一書中實例中,采用兩臺不同的虛擬機.即一臺虛擬機作為服務(wù)端,另外一臺虛擬機作為客戶端. 現(xiàn)象: 兩臺電腦各自互ping可通 客戶端訪問local可行 客戶機訪問服務(wù)端報錯:No r ...

重新認(rèn)識Box Model、IFC、BFC和Collapsing margins

尊重原創(chuàng),轉(zhuǎn)載自:?http://www.cnblogs.com/fsjohnhuang/p/5259121.html?肥子John^_^ 前言 ? 盒子模型作為CSS基礎(chǔ)中的基礎(chǔ),曾一度以為掌握了I ...

相對布局RelativeLayout

一. public class RelativeLayout extends ViewGroup java.lang.Object ???? android.view.View ? ???? an ...

xx通CGI流量控制

流量控制共分2步,首先在CGI框架對用戶的ip作限制,第二限制每個CGI的流量. ? 一.基于IP的流量控制 用共享內(nèi)存(shm)的方式保存基于ip的訪問信息. 配置文件中

C++:vector的用法詳解

總結(jié)

以上是生活随笔為你收集整理的oracle日期相减工作日_Oracle 计算两个日期间隔的天数、月数和年数的全部內(nèi)容,希望文章能夠幫你解決所遇到的問題。

如果覺得生活随笔網(wǎng)站內(nèi)容還不錯,歡迎將生活随笔推薦給好友。